Description

The Department of Defense, specifically the Department of the Navy through NAVSUP Weapon Systems Support Mechanicsburg, is soliciting bids for the procurement of straight thread pins under the solicitation titled "PIN, STRAIGHT, THREAD." This procurement involves the manufacturing of items classified under NAICS code 332618, which pertains to Other Fabricated Wire Product Manufacturing, and PSC code 5315, which includes nails, machine keys, and pins. The items are critical for various defense applications, emphasizing the importance of quality and compliance with specified technical requirements.
